Nachavule is a 2008 Indian Telugu romantic comedy film directed by Ravi Babu and produced by Ramoji Rao. The film stars Tanish and Maadhavi Latha in their lead acting debuts, with Raksha and Y. Kasi Viswanath in supporting roles. The story follows Luv Kumar, a young man in Hyderabad who believes that getting one girlfriend will lead to many more. He befriends Anu but takes her love for granted, leading to heartbreak and a series of events that force him to confront his immaturity. The film is notable for its witty dialogues, refreshing direction, and a hard-hitting message about valuing relationships. It was commercially successful and won three Nandi Awards, including Best Supporting Actress for Raksha. The music was composed by Shekar Chandra. Nachavule was released on 19 December 2008.

Storyline

Luv Kumar thinks the first girlfriend is the hardest to get. After that, he believes, girls will come flooding in. He meets Anu and uses her as a stepping stone. But when his lies break her heart and a leaked video humiliates her, Luv must learn the hard way that love is not a game.
